Overview

Postcode NE63 9FQ is located in an urban city, within the Hirst ward of Northumberland in the North East region, and forms part of the Ashington East area. It has very high deprivation and very high crime levels, with around 146.4 crimes per 1,000 residents per year. The average income per household in Ashington East is £42,301 per year. The nearest station is Ashington located about 1.1 miles away. There are 5 primary and 1 secondary schools in the area.

Property prices in Hirst

Based on 43 recent sales, the median property price is £80,000 in Hirst area, with individual transactions ranging from £18,202 up to £289,000.
